Number of unemployed down 13.1% y-o-y in April

The number of unemployed in April dropped an annual 13.1%, the Statistical Service said, adding that 8,118 persons were registered at the District Labour Offices as jobless on the last day of April 2025.

Based on the seasonally adjusted data that show the trend of unemployment, the number of registered unemployed for April 2025 decreased to 9,655 persons, in comparison to 10,035 in the previous month.

In comparison with April 2024, a decrease of 1,225 persons or 13.1% was recorded, attributed mainly to the sectors of financial and insurance activities, construction, trade, accommodation and food service activities, as well as to the decrease recorded for newcomers in the labour market.
